Output 1618d3221ca3e6038167ecd3bdf5861a94d4159309c948c2e442015314c475ad:0

value
711243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c1e6d37ebba9e3c66c5bd1b17211e4e12fc07ed OP_EQUAL
address
3Mku2psAyBN9aTP5DDREdkhpRiX5WmAK5n
transaction
1618d3221ca3e6038167ecd3bdf5861a94d4159309c948c2e442015314c475ad